The Royal Hotel is Scarborough's most prestigious hotel, offering guests high quality accommodation. The grand regency architecture of the public areas contrasts beautifully with the contemporary style bedrooms.The Royal Hotel is a 3 star (aa + rac) hotel located in the heart of Scarborough, overlooking the beautiful South Bay and within easy reach of all the town's attractions, including the SeaLife Centre, Spa Complex and the many parks and gardens, together with theatres and great shopping. The spectacular Royal Dining Room offers a unique window on the resort of Scarborough with its prime position overlooking the St. Nicholas Cliff Gardens and the stunning South Bay. Serving superb traditional English cuisine together with an extensive wine list.
The hotel regretfully does not accept stag or hen nights and groups over 10 must check with the Hotel Central Reservations Department for availability. These bookings may be subject to a Reservation Bond at the discretion of the management. The hotel does not, regretfully, have its own car-parking facilities, but has an arrangement with the local ncp at a reduced rate. We have an unloading bay directly outside of the hotel.
